ZIM Vs IND, 2nd ODI: India Beat Zimbabwe By Five Wickets To Clinch Series – In Pics

Sanju Samson produced a responsible unbeaten 43 after a clinical bowling display, led by pacer Shardul Thakur, as India sailed to a five-wicket win over Zimbabwe in the second ODI to take an unassailable 2-0 lead in the three-match series on Saturday. Sent into bowl, comeback man Thakur (3/38 in seven overs) brilliantly set it up and became the wrecker-in-chief as the Indian bowlers once again came out on top to skittle out Zimbabwe for 161. Shikhar Dhawan and Shubman Gill then showed their same flair and authority, even as the duo batted in different positions this time, posting identical scores of 33. But the duo could not steer the team home this time as India endured some anxious moments in the middle following the departure of Dhawan. But with just 65 runs needed from 36 overs, Deepak Hooda and Samson produced a sensible stand of 56-run together to virtually seal the fate of the match.
